Title :
Multidimensional signaling and per-symbol detection for high data rate DS-CDMA systems

Abstract :
A novel multidimensional signaling and per-symbol detection are proposed for the uplink of DS-CDMA systems to achieve a constant envelope modulation and coherent demodulation while providing variable and high data rates. Unlike the conventional precoding technique, this scheme increases the data rate by compensating a loss in the information rate incurred by the constant envelope signal. It is shown that an optimum rate of multidimensional signaling can be found for the bit SNRs of interest, and the proposed scheme with 4-parallel multicodes offers significant gain over conventional DS-CDMA
